For the day of the Lord of hosts shall be upon every one that is proud and lofty, and upon every one that is lifted up; and he shall be brought low:
About Isaiah 2:12
Isaiah 2:12 from Isaiah speaks directly to Pride and Humility in Scripture, offering wisdom drawn from the Old Testament tradition. This passage in the prophecy literature of Scripture is widely cherished by students and teachers alike.
